Add 40/6 and 21/9
1st number: 6 4/6, 2nd number: 2 3/9
40/6 + 21/9 is 9/1.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 9 is 18
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 18 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 3 = 18,
40/6 = 40 × 3/6 × 3 = 120/18 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 9 × 2 = 18,
21/9 = 21 × 2/9 × 2 = 42/18 - Add the two like fractions:
120/18 + 42/18 = 120 + 42/18 = 162/18 - 162/18 simplified gives 9/1
- So, 40/6 + 21/9 = 9/1
